In Mumbai now and having a really bad time!! We got picked up from the airport yesterday and taken to our hotel. It is in the most horrible area - definitely down town Mumbai and the hotel is horrible (like really disgusting with windows that don't shut properly, broken lights etc). And the hotel was full of local people, there were no tourists to be seen anywhere. We felt completely distraught and went straight to the Internet cafe to find the numbers of the airline (to try and bring our flight forward), the number for STA (who we'd booked the hotel through - we've already started on the complaint letter and taken pictures of the hotel!) and the number for the hotel where staying in in Bankok (to see if we can stay a day earlier). Well without much success (as it was about 6pm by this point and most places were shut) we went back to the hotel, made a list of things to do the next day, played some games to try and take our minds off things then tried to get some sleep. The whole of our floor was filled with families that all seemed to know eachother and spent the whole night in the corridors shouting and little children kept screaming and throwing marbles at our door so didn't get a great nights sleep! But on a brighter note, we phoned the airline this morning and are going to Bankok a day earlier, leaving at 5am tomorrow morning - someone was definitely looking down on us today!! Patrice spoke to this women when we were in Goa who had been to Mumbai and recommended this resaurant. It's about an hour from the hotel but we got a cab to this area this morning (only cost about 3 pounds) and are spending the day down here. It's a much better area, quite a few tourists around and it's by the coast. We're planning to go back to the hotel at about 9ish, have a shower, pack our backpacks and head to the airport at about 12 and spend a few hours there! So only really about 10 hours left in Mumbai thank god!
